    I've had a gift card for chilis for a few years now.. so decided to use to. Let me start by saying I'm not a fan of chain restaurants so tend to avoid them. The positives: we were greeted warmly by the host and seated- very nice man made us feel welcome. Our waitress was prompt and the food came out quickly and hot. She came back a few times to check in on us. The kids meals were great values and my daughter liked her cheeseburger sliders. The negatives: the salt. Now this is why I avoid chain restaurants I know there isn't a "chef" in the back and things come premade and are cooked / reheated. I got the steak fajitas. So. Much. Salt. They came out sizzling with nice sides - but so. Much. Salt. I'd come back again just for the service but would try a salad or something. Great place to go with the kids.

    I gotta say this Chili's is very much big time one of my go-to places in this area for a solid pig out and also for some low-priced toddies that contain a respectable amount of alcohol. My One and I have been here numerous times and our milieu is to get the chips and salsa which is to die for. The chips are wicked pissah being house-made and not too salty and nicely oily and the texture and krunch are exceptional and the mouth feel is wicked haptically pleasing. I usually opt for the Alex Burger which is a southwest thing featuring a half-pound patty and bacon and avocado and cheese and jalapenos and a spicy sauce and other stuff. This is a very greasy and yum-O situation and contains enough fat to get me through my day. I always get an extra patty (double), and this is quite a substantial burger and quite filling when in situ with the fries which have always been hot n' fresh. I would like to add that I am normally against getting burgers at restaurants because they are usually just way too pricey and are often depressing with their janky, crumbly buns and teenie patty and boring "whatever" toppings. This Alex Burger is absolutely wonderful and this entree pairs nicely with the 5-buck special toddy which is actually kinda boozy. Though this isn't the Ritz, I have found the service to be excellent with minimal gliches. I see that many peeps lambaste and hate on Chilis but I do say peep out this place and get the Alex Burger. And make it a double!
